No Bake Gingerbread Bars
If you’re craving a treat packed with gingerbread flavor but want to skip the oven, these no-bake gingerbread bars are the answer! The best part? They come together in minutes with just a handful of ingredients, making them a perfect addition to any holiday dessert spread!

- 1 ½ cups Gingersnap Cookies
- ½ cup Cream Cheese Full fat, room temperature
- ¼ cup Powdered Sugar
- 1 teaspoon Cinnamon
In a food processor, crush the gingersnap cookies. You can also crush them in a Ziploc bag with a rolling pin. They should be very small, like breadcrumbs.
In a large mixing bowl, add the cream cheese and gingersnap crumbs. Mix well.
Add the powdered sugar and cinnamon. Mix well.
Press the cookie batter into an 8x8 inch baking pan lined with parchment paper. Refrigerate for at least 2 hours before cutting.
- To make these bars even more fun, add a drizzle of melted white chocolate or a sprinkle of powdered sugar before serving.
- Make sure to allow the bars to chill for at least two hours before serving. This will help the bars stay together when you are cutting them.
